Job Description :

This position reports to the Clinical Supervisor and is responsible for providing milieu-based therapy for patients primarily ages 5 to 13 and enrolled in grades 1st through 8th at Mount Saint Vincentâ€s Day Treatment Program.

The School Social Worker is responsible for directing all aspects of the patient and familyâ€s clinical care within the educational setting, and works in close partnership with the Teachers, Educational Mental Health Workers and school staff.

As a School Social Worker you need to know how to :

  • Provide consistent affective education and therapy to patients within the school, and their families. Therapy includes milieu-based individual therapy, family therapy, and group therapy
  • Utilize a Social Emotional Learning (SEL) platform within the school. Responsible for implementing and overseeing assigned SEL courses to patients on your caseload
  • Actively engage with patients in the classroom milieu according to the daily schedule and individual treatment plans
  • Conduct assessments including comprehensive diagnostic evaluations and Functional Behavior Assessments (FBA)
  • Write reports including initial evaluations / assessments, treatment plans, treatment notes, monthly updates, discharge plans, as well as all other required documentation
  • Monitor caseload for treatment progress or regression and update treatment plans as necessary in compliance with agency timelines
  • Collaborate and consult with appropriate stakeholders
  • Provide case management for the patients and families on your caseload
  • Responsible for discharge planning, providing aftercare recommendations, and providing aftercare referrals as appropriate
  • Attend, actively contribute to, and / or facilitate required meetings, which includes Individualized Education Plan (IEP) meetings for patients on your caseload
  • Maintain compliance with agency policies / guidelines and regulatory standards
  • Is sensitive to the cultural differences among the children, families and staff and responds appropriately and sensitively to those differences.
